POSITION SUMMARY

The Registered Respiratory Therapist will be competent to care for patients of all ages to include infants children adolescents adult and geriatric population dependent on the area assigned. This individual performs the duties and responsibilities outlined below as assigned under minimal supervision from the Respiratory Care Department leadership team and the Medical Directors of Respiratory Care. The Registered Respiratory Therapist performs these assigned duties and responsibilities according to regulatory standards clinical practice guidelines policies and procedures approved by the Medical Directors and Administration. This individual will frequently make independent decisions regarding modification of therapy in accordance with clinical practice guidelines policies and procedures.

ACCOUNTABILITIES

  1. Achieves and maintains a level of competency to perform prescribed therapeutic and diagnostic procedures within their scope of practice as required per business unit in accordance to departmental competency standards which include general care critical care emergency care and diagnostic procedures including but not limited to the following:
  • General Care: patient identification and assessment medical gas delivery medication administration via nebulizers and MDI/DPI bronchopulmonary hygiene and hyperinflation therapy
  • Critical Care: initiation management and weaning of invasive and non-invasive ventilation; airway management and suction including tracheostomy endotracheal and pharyngeal; cuff and ETCO2 monitoring intubation and extubation; set-up calibration insertion (arterial lines) and maintenance of indwelling lines and catheters and high risk newborn deliveries
  • Emergency Care: responds to rapid responses and emergency codes; performs c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) airway management and actively participates in patient stabilization internal and external transports
  • Diagnostic Care: blood sampling and analysis specimen collection continuous and/or noninvasive monitoring bedside pulmonary function screens spontaneous breathing parameters and electrocardiograms (EKG)

Note: critical tests and values will be reported in a timely manner per Hospital Policy.

  1. Safely assembles operates and trouble shoots therapeutic and diagnostic equipment required for patient care including but not limited to the following:
  • Gas administration monitoring and analyzing devices including flow meters and regulators blenders cylinders and bulk systems compressors analyzers and pulse oximeters
  • Mechanical devices including mechanical ventilators manometers gauges spirometers and EKG machines.
  • Laboratory equipment for blood gas analysis
  • Age specific patient care equipment including resuscitation equipment oral and nasal airways endotracheal and tracheal tubes
  • Equipment disinfection and sterilization

Requirements
  • Education: A graduate of an accredited respiratory therapy program and maintain credential as a Registered Respiratory Therapist (RRT) by the National Board for Respiratory Care (NBRC).
  • Skills: Must be able to input and retrieve computer information
  • Years of Experience:
  • License: Must be licensed to render respiratory care services by the respective state(s) of practice Ohio and/or Michigan
  • Certification: Must hold current BLS certification
